Abstract

This study analyzes the effects of perceived transaction cost, dissatisfaction, perceived ease of use, perceived value, and inertia on users' switching intention to shift from OVO to QRIS as a payment method in Grab ride-hailing services. Grounded in the Push–Pull–Mooring (PPM) framework, the study adopts a quantitative approach by administering an online questionnaire to 200 Generation Z and young Millennial respondents aged 18–35 years in the Greater Jakarta area (Jabodetabek) who had experience using OVO and were familiar with the QRIS payment feature on the Grab application. The data were analyzed using Partial Least Squares Structural Equation Modeling (PLS-SEM) with SmartPLS 4. The measurement model confirmed that all constructs achieved the required validity and reliability criteria. The structural model indicated that dissatisfaction, perceived ease of use, and perceived value had significant positive effects on switching intention, whereas perceived transaction cost and inertia were not found to have significant effects. These findings suggest that users' intention to switch to QRIS is primarily driven by dissatisfaction with the existing payment method and by the perceived convenience and value offered by QRIS. The study provides practical insights for Grab and digital payment providers in formulating strategies to accelerate the adoption of interoperable digital payment systems.
